Nationalism in France
Class and Nation Since 1789First published in 1990, Nationalism in France (now with a new preface by the author) is a concise history of the post-revolutionary period in France and provides at the same time an original study of the evolution of French Nationalism since 1789.

The Trial of Emma Cunningham
Murder and Scandal in the Victorian EraThe alleged 1857 murder of a wealthy Bond Street dentist by a Emma Cunningham, a young widow he was believed to be sexually involved with, served to distract many New Yorkers from the deepening national crisis over slavery in America. This reexamination places the story in its social and political context.

The Fenian Problem
Insurgency and Terrorism in a Liberal State, 1858-1874Addresses dramatic and tragic rescues of arrested Fenian leaders, the formation of a Fenian squad to engage in assassinations of suspected informers and policemen, the bombing of a London prison that brought death and destruction to a neighbouring street, public executions of several Fenians, and the quality of British justice.
